Output 17e4f62578bc17ee72804b2b879d7ad32bcd718258548825c5d2680b369b20b3:0

value
2643633
script pubkey
OP_0 OP_PUSHBYTES_20 3bff74e635fea6d23777b8a351eea718616dc53b
address
ltc1q80lhfe34l6ndydmhhz34rm48rpskm3fmssu2fz
transaction
17e4f62578bc17ee72804b2b879d7ad32bcd718258548825c5d2680b369b20b3
spent
true